In the ever-evolving wave of technological advancements, intelligent rehabilitation is gradually moving into the core areas of the children's welfare service system. In July 2025, the Shanghai Children's Welfare Institute joined hands with BrainCo to successfully hold the "Brain-Computer Empowerment · Digital Intelligence Navigation" cooperation exchange meeting, jointly unveiling the Welfare Children’s Brain-Computer Rehabilitation Innovation Training Center. This marks a pioneering step for children's welfare institutions in the field of intelligent health care for children with special needs.

At the roundtable conference held during the unveiling ceremony, guests from various fields engaged in high-level, in-depth discussions on "how to promote the implementation and integration of digital intelligence rehabilitation technology in the field of child welfare."

Bringing Technology Home, Expanding the "Last Mile" of Rehabilitation Services
Nini's mother, a representative of the parents of children attending the summer daycare program, stated,Brain-Computer Interface Technology Enters Rehabilitation Families: A Mutual Approach of Technological Warmth and People's Needs. She mentioned that brain-computer devices have been included in the electric assistive devices catalog for people with disabilities in Shanghai, allowing high technology to truly benefit families of children with special needs. This not only alleviates financial burdens but also provides professional support for home-based rehabilitation. She expressed gratitude to the Children’s Welfare Institute and BrainCo for bringing technological achievements into rehabilitation practices and hopes that future scientific innovations will continue to expand the accessibility and effectiveness of rehabilitation technologies, benefiting more children with special needs.
